Henry E Ham 1835–1909 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 24 Jun 1835

Birth Location: Canterbury, Merrimack, New Hampshire, USA

Death Date: 4 Jan 1909

Death Location: South Bend Ward 4, St Joseph County, Indiana, USA

Father: John Ham

Mother: Sabrina Clark

Spouse(s): Orra Poole, Bessie Corning

Children(s): Ella Ham

In 1835, Henry E Ham entered the world in Canterbury, Merrimack, New Hampshire, USA, born to John Ham And Sabrina Clark. Henry E Ham married Bessie Corning, Orra Hannah Poole, and had children including Ella Ham. Henry E Ham passed away in 1909 in South Bend Ward 4, St Joseph County, Indiana, USA.
